Is Santa Clarita safe to live?

Santa Clarita consistently remains one of the safest cities in California as well as in the nation. Overall, Santa Clarita is the 4th safest among California cities with a population of at least 150,000 people and is the 13th safest in the United States.

Is Santa Clarita poor?

The poverty rate in Santa Clarita is 8.8\%. One out of every 11.4 residents of Santa Clarita lives in poverty. How many people in Santa Clarita, California live in poverty? 18,172 of 207,348 Santa Clarita residents reported income levels below the poverty line in the last year.

What type of people live in Santa Clarita?

Santa Clarita Demographics

  • White: 70.96\%
  • Asian: 11.12\%
  • Other race: 7.22\%
  • Two or more races: 5.91\%
  • Black or African American: 3.93\%
  • Native American: 0.76\%
  •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ander: 0.09\%

Is Santa Clarita a real place?

Santa Clarita (/ˌsæntə kləˈriːtə/; Spanish for “Little St. Clare”) is a city in northwestern Los Angeles County, California. With a 2020 census population of 228,673, it is the third-largest city by population in Los Angeles County, and the 17th-largest in the state of California.
